Step 7
Note these Cisco Prime Network Registrar installation default directories and make any appropriate changes to meet
your needs:
The installation directory path with spaces is not supported on non-Windows platforms and not recommended
on Windows (except for the "Program Files" path).
Note
If you are upgrading, the upgrade process autodetects the installation directory from the previous release.
Note
Windows default locations:
Do not specify the
\Program Files (x86) or \Program Files or \ProgramData
for the location of the Cisco
Prime Network Registrar data, logs, and temporary files. If you do this, the behavior of Cisco Prime Network
Registrar may be unpredictable because of Windows security.
